the muse of rely on: Unmatched basic safety in LiFePO₄ Chemistry
Safety may be the bedrock of any reputable engineering, Particularly one which retailers sizeable amounts of energy. This is where LiFePO₄ technological know-how basically outshines its counterparts, for instance Nickel Cobalt Manganese (NCM) or Nickel Cobalt Aluminum (NCA) batteries.
Superior Thermal Stability: Resisting Runaway
the main safety advantage of LiFePO₄ lies in its extremely secure chemical framework. The phosphorus-oxygen (P-O) bond throughout the phosphate crystal is extremely potent, which makes it remarkably immune to breaking down underneath worry. Which means that even if subjected to overcharging, Bodily harm, or higher temperatures, the battery is way more unlikely to launch oxygen. the discharge of oxygen is usually a key catalyst for thermal runaway—a perilous chain reaction that can cause fire and explosions in other lithium-ion chemistries. This inherent balance helps make LiFePO₄ The best option for community infrastructure, residential Strength storage, and critical clinical units where failure is not really an alternative.
Inherently Protected resources: No Cobalt, No dilemma
an important issue contributing for the instability and toxicity of other batteries may be the existence of cobalt. LiFePO₄ chemistry wholly eradicates cobalt, a volatile and ethically problematic heavy metallic. This layout selection not just boosts thermal security but will also helps make the battery safer for human Make contact with and fewer dangerous to the ecosystem in the function of the breach. By getting rid of cobalt and nickel, LiFePO₄ batteries current a lessen risk profile throughout their whole lifecycle.
Stable general performance for significant purposes
The electrochemical stability of LiFePO₄ translates on to trustworthy and predictable effectiveness. For industries like telecommunications, data facilities, and Health care, wherever uninterrupted ability is very important, this consistency is priceless. The lowered hazard of sudden failure or thermal situations allows for more assured deployment in densely populated spots and sensitive environments.
A Cleaner Footprint: The Eco-welcoming character of LiFePO₄
past operational protection, the environmental qualifications of the battery are based on its content composition and lifecycle impression. LiFePO₄ stands out to be a truly cleaner technological innovation.
Toxin-absolutely free Composition
LiFePO₄ batteries are free of charge from your poisonous large metals that plague more mature battery systems and in many cases some fashionable lithium-ion variants. They have no guide, mercury, or cadmium. In addition, their Main components—iron and phosphate—are ample, economical, and non-harmful supplies uncovered Obviously within the earth. This cleanse composition drastically lessens the environmental hazard linked to manufacturing, managing, and eventual disposal or recycling.
minimized Environmental effect in generation and Recycling
The mining of cobalt and nickel is linked to critical environmental degradation and unethical labor methods. By depending on iron and phosphate, the sourcing of LiFePO₄ resources carries a A lot lighter environmental and social stress. Moreover, the recycling approach for LiFePO₄ batteries is less complicated and safer. since there isn't any important but harmful metals like cobalt to recover, the method can target reclaiming lithium, copper, and aluminum with much less Electrical power and less harmful byproducts.
A decreased Carbon Footprint throughout the Lifecycle
From raw content extraction to finish-of-everyday living recycling, the full carbon footprint of the LiFePO₄ battery is drastically reduced than that of an NCM or NCA battery. The decreased Electricity depth of fabric processing along with the battery’s Extraordinary longevity signify that fewer batteries need to be made after a while, conserving resources and reducing cumulative emissions.
Maximizing each and every Watt: The unmatched effectiveness of LiFePO₄
effectiveness in a very battery is just not pretty much energy; it really is about minimizing squander. squandered Vitality is an environmental and financial Expense. LiFePO₄ technological know-how is engineered for maximum efficiency in three critical areas.
substantial Charge/Discharge Efficiency
LiFePO₄ batteries boast a round-trip effectiveness of ninety five% or greater. Which means that For each one hundred models of Strength place into your battery, a lot more than 95 units can be obtained to be used. In contrast, direct-acid batteries frequently struggle to exceed 85% effectiveness. For purposes like solar Vitality storage, this distinction is monumental. It means significantly less Electricity is wasted in the course of everyday charging and discharging cycles, maximizing the output of renewable resources and cutting down reliance about the grid.
Outstanding Cycle lifetime and Longevity
Perhaps the most significant effectiveness achieve emanates from LiFePO₄’s remarkable lifespan. These batteries can endure 4,000 to 6,000 comprehensive cost-discharge cycles or even more whilst retaining a significant proportion in their unique ability. This really is four to 10 instances lengthier than most other lithium-ion chemistries and in excess of 20 moments for a longer time than standard lead-acid batteries. This outstanding longevity significantly minimizes the necessity for Regular replacements, conserving the raw products, Electricity, and labor required to manufacture new batteries. It signifies a monumental reduction in prolonged-time period waste.
Low Self-Discharge amount
every time a battery isn't in use, it slowly loses its charge. LiFePO₄ batteries have an extremely lower self-discharge rate, typically losing only 1-three% in their cost a month. This helps make them perfect for backup power and crisis lights devices, ensuring that Electrical power saved right now is still readily available months or months later on. This attribute stops the gradual but constant squander of Electricity widespread in significantly less secure chemistries.

Meeting world wide requirements: LiFePO₄ and Global Compliance
The eco-friendly credentials of LiFePO₄ technological innovation are validated by its capability to meet and exceed stringent Intercontinental environmental and protection requirements. Certifications for example UL (for protection), IEC 62133 (for secondary cells), RoHS (Restriction of dangerous Substances), and UN38.three (for transportation safety) are regular for prime-good quality LiFePO₄ products. This worldwide compliance assures consumers that they are investing in a technological know-how that's not only powerful but also globally identified as Safe and sound and environmentally liable.
Powering a Greener earth: vital Applications for LiFePO₄ Batteries
The distinctive combination of basic safety, cleanliness, and effectiveness makes LiFePO₄ an ideal suit for your developing amount of eco-acutely aware purposes.
Renewable Power Storage: Its very long cycle existence and significant effectiveness help it become the Leading choice for photo voltaic and wind energy storage methods.
Electric Mobility and Transportation: Its protection and toughness are ideal for electric powered buses, forklifts, and utility motor vehicles that involve reliable daily operation. The popular 18650 battery structure, when created with LiFePO₄ chemistry, provides a robust and compact power source for smaller devices and e-bikes.
important Infrastructure: knowledge centers, telecom towers, and hospitals depend on LiFePO₄ for uninterruptible electricity supplies (UPS) which might be Protected, very long-lasting, and demand small maintenance.
